The 2008 Grand Caravan is a 4-door, 7-passenger mini van, available in two trims, the SE and the SXT. Upon introduction, the SE is equipped with a standard 3.3-liter, V6, NL-horsepower engine. A 4-speed automatic transmission with overdrive is standard. The SXT is equipped with a standard 3.8-liter, V6, NL-horsepower engine that achieves 16-mpg in the city and 23-mpg on the highway. A 6-speed automatic transmission with overdrive is standard.
